Yankees Lose Late, 2-1
|
The home crowd had a good time watching the New York Yankees and Colorado Rockies get after it.
The Rockies grabbed a win, 2-1, at Colorado Field, overcoming a fine effort from New York pitcher Anthony Gasper. Gasper went 7 innings and allowed 1 run. The Rockies, at 46-37, sit in third place in the National League Central Division.
Had Jesus Pena not delivered a key base hit in the bottom of the eighth, the outcome might have been different. Instead, with two down and runners on 1st and 3rd, Pena hit a run-scoring single. That made the score 2-1, in favor of the Rockies.
"As well as we've been playing, I think we can play even better," said Colorado manager Trevor Taka.
